Magic Dream Bars Recipe

Ingredients: 1 20 ounce tube of sugar cookie dough, I can sweetened condensed milk, 1 cup mini m&m’sã baking bits, 1 cup chocolate chips, 1 cup butterscotch chips, 1 – 1 ½ cups of flaked coconut, 1 cup honey roasted peanuts, coarsely chopped

Directions:1. Preheat oven to 375°F. Lightly grease 13 x 9 baking pan. 2. Cut sugar cookies in 1 inch slices. Cover bottom of pan and press dough together to form bottom crust. 3. Bake at 375°F for 8 to 10 minutes or until set. Drizzle cookie crust with sweetened condensed milk. Then layer the m&m’sã, chocolate chips, coconut, and honey roasted nuts. Gently press down so toppings will stick to milk. 4. Bake at 375°F for 15 – 25 minutes or until golden brown. Cool completely. Cut into bars. Store in tightly covered container. Variations: Substitute any kind of nut you prefer in place of honey roasted peanuts. Substitute any flavor of chip in place of chocolate chip. |

Servings:24 bars |

Notes: This is a copy-cat recipe from “The Corner Bakery” that is now located on Hwy 407 across from the Target Shopping center in Flower Mound, Texas. If you cut them as big as they do, you will only get about 10 bars. Experiment and enjoy!
